Output 93debc66bee690c3aa0ea12b8200d18f42ec54a0719b91b320958412e060c8dc:8

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f446db663559395c475b75d048cfbde3c47a0b OP_EQUAL
address
3LC93wbScShVKY8D4JGQYdDQVkkJHvQ8i9
transaction
93debc66bee690c3aa0ea12b8200d18f42ec54a0719b91b320958412e060c8dc
spent
true